Video Recording Under Strict Data Protection Regulations
Camera systems are used in a wide range of applications, including traffic monitoring, web and dashcams, retail, scientific research, healthcare, and industrial manufacturing. Large volumes of video and image data are also generated daily in development projects for advanced driver assistance systems (ADAS) and autonomous driving.
This data is often captured in public spaces, where individuals, vehicles, or license plates may be clearly identifiable. Since this constitutes personal data, applicable data protection regulations, such as the GDPR in the European Union, must be strictly observed. This applies regardless of the specific use case, as soon as identifiable features are recorded.
On-Premise Anonymization
Upload videos and images from any recording system to your local environment and route the data through the anonymization workflow.
Files from an input folder are intelligently distributed across multiple instances for high throughput. Use your existing CPUs and GPUs to speed up the anonymization process. There is only insignificant loss of data quality during the processing, the input format corresponds to the output format. Codec, container and frame rate remain unchanged during anonymization.
The software vAnonymize works completely offline during runtime and without sharing sensitive data with third parties.


Supported Data Formats/Codecs
- AVI (H.264 (Baseline-Profile), YUV420p, MJPEG, YUVj420p, RAW, BGR24/RGB24)
- MP4 (H.264 (Baseline-Profile), YUV420p, MJPEG, YUVj420p)
- JPG (JPEG (ITU T81), JFIF (ITU T871))
- PNG (RGB, RGBA, GRAY, GRAYA, Output: RGB24)
- MF4 (H.264 (Baseline-Profile), YUV420p, JPEG (ITU T81/ITU T.871), YUV422, RAW12)
- Rosbag (JPEG (ITU T81), JFIF (ITU T871))
